Bhat Khera

Bhat Khera is a village located in Pirawa tehsil of Jhalawar district in Rajasthan, India. It is situated 24km away from sub-district headquarter Pirawa (tehsildar office) and 42km away from district headquarter Jhalawar. As per 2009 stats, Kali Talai is the gram panchayat of Bhat Khera village.

About Bhat Khera

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Bhat Khera is 105048. The village spans a total geographical area of 128.22 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 326036. Pirawa is nearest town to Bhat Khera village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 24km away.

When it comes to local governance, Bhat Khera village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Jhalrapatan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Jhalawar-Baran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Bhat Khera

Below is a concise population overview of Bhat Khera as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 4 2 2
Child Population (0–6 yrs) N/A N/A N/A
Scheduled Castes (SC) 4 2 2
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population N/A N/A N/A
Illiterate Population 4 2 2

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Bhat Khera village:

  • The total population of Bhat Khera village is around 4, including approximately 2 males and 2 females, with a sex ratio of 1000 females per 1,000 males.
  • Bhat Khera village has 4 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
  • There are around 1 households in Bhat Khera village.

Connectivity of Bhat Khera

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Bhat Khera. As per the 2011 stats, Bhat Khera had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
